

Mary Bullock Thompson, 88 yrs. of age passed away on July 9, 2016, in Alabaster, AL. She was preceded in death by her husband of 68 yrs, A. W. (Tommy) Thompson. They had four children; Edward E. (Patty), Atlanta, GA, Janet (John Baldwin), Aiken, SC, Jeffrey W (Beth), Alabaster, AL and L. Dale, Alabaster, AL.
Prior to moving to Aiken, SC in 1971, she was a member of The First United Methodist Church of Hueytown, AL, later moving to St. John's United Methodist Church in Aiken where she was involved with her Circle meetings and fund raisers. Her health declined and they moved back to Alabama approximately five years ago.
She has eight grandchildren; Brian, Kristen, Natalie, Ashton, Melissa, Megan, April and Brantley. She has five great-grandchildren; Joshua, Austin, Easton, Mila and Emma. She is also survived by her sister-in-law, Betty Jean Cassidy.
Mrs. Thompson enjoyed many things, one of which was being President of The Little League Baseball Teams for several years. She was always involved with everything her children wanted to do. She started playing the piano at five years old; loved readiņg, traveling and camping, never meeting a stranger. She also loved to cook and bake. She always had smiles and hugs for everyone.
